2512 Durwood St, Austin, TX, 78704 (current address)
2512 Durwood St, Austin, TX, 78704 (2019)
We found 1 person named Ubaldo Olvera in Austin, TX. View Ubaldo’s phone numbers, current address, previous addresses, emails, family members, neighbors and associates.
Frequently asked questions for Ubaldo Olvera
Ubaldo Olvera is or will soon be 50.
Reach Ubaldo Olvera at the following email addresses: [email protected] or [email protected]
Ubaldo Olvera resides at 2512 Durwood St, Austin, Texas, 78704 and has been living there since 2021.
Previously, Ubaldo Olvera lived at the following address: 2512 Durwood St, Austin, Texas, 78704.